I can try and grab a picture later, but its a Iron Pontil New Orleans soda that says P Pertdorff and another name on it. Its an ice blue color and have NEVER been able to get any info on this. We bought it for 7 bucks way back in the day and something tells me its worth a ton more. Any guesses on what this is?

I have a book that lists a P. Pertdorf & A. Wendel that sold for $300.00 in 2008, listed as teal and no mention of condition if that helps. Also and aqua one went for $120.00. Pertdorf, now there's a name for ya.

DETAILS

Key
1,585

Top
BLOB

Form
SODA

Provenance
NEW ORLEANS

Front
P. PERTDORF (^) / MINERAL / WATER / & A. WENDEL (v) / N. O. (THE "N" & "O" ARE WIDELY SPACED AT OPPOSITE SIDES OF THE ARCHED EMBOSSING ABOVE)

Back
(PLAIN)

Color
BLUE AQUA

Age Circa
1857

Base
IP

Rarity
1

Dollar Val
500

Comments
IN BUSINESS IN 1857 ONLY.
